Old Fashioned Homemade Lemonade

There is nothing more refreshing than a glass of old fashioned homemade lemonade. This recipe is simple and easy to make on a hot day!

– White Sugar – Water – Lemon Juice – Water – Ice – Lemon Slices

Ingredients

In a small saucepan add the sugar and the first measure of water. Heat over medium low until the sugar has fully dissolved into the water.

1

Leave the simple syrup mixture to cool for 10-15 minutes while juicing the lemons. Use a lemon juicer to juice about 6 or 7 lemons until you have one cup of lemon juice.

2

Measure out 1 cup or 250ml of the simple syrup and mix with the cup of freshly squeezed lemon juice. This makes the lemonade syrup.

3

To serve add the lemonade syrup to a pitcher. Top up the pitcher with 4 cups or 1L of water, a few handfuls of ice and some slices of lemon.
